Mhc Regency Lakes Dam in Frederick, Virginia, is a privately owned dam regulated by the Department of Conservation and Recreation.

Standing at a height of 17.75 feet, the dam provides a storage capacity of 87.54 acre-feet, with a normal storage level of 43.12 acre-feet. With a structural height matching its hydraulic height, the dam spans a length of 275 feet and covers a surface area of 8.8 acres.
Although the hazard potential of Mhc Regency Lakes Dam is listed as undetermined and its condition assessment is not rated, the dam is subject to regular state inspection, enforcement, and permitting processes. The dam's emergency action plan status, risk assessment, and management measures are yet to be determined.
